What is Yoshinoya Holdings Co EV-to-EBITDA?

E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, Yoshinoya Holdings Co's enterprise value is 円187,950 Mil. Yoshinoya Holdings Co's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Nov. 2023 was 円8,598 Mil. Therefore, Yoshinoya Holdings Co's EV-to-EBITDA for today is 21.86.

Yoshinoya Holdings Co EV-to-EBITDA Calculation

Yoshinoya Holdings Co's EV-to-EBITDA for today is calculated as:

EV-to-EBITDA=Enterprise Value (Today)/EBITDA (TTM)
=187950.115/8598
=21.86

Yoshinoya Holdings Co's current Enterprise Value is 円187,950 Mil.
Yoshinoya Holdings Co's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Nov. 2023 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円8,598 Mil.

Yoshinoya Holdings Co Ltd owns, operates, and franchises thousands of restaurants primarily in Japan. The company has five business segments: Yoshinoya, a restaurant brand that serves gyudon and other fast food and accounts for roughly half of the company's sales; Hanamaru, a self-service sanuki udon restaurant brand; Arcmeal, which operates Steak-no-Don, Shabu Shabu Don-tei, Steak House Volks, and Don Italiano restaurants; Kyotaru, which operates takeout sushi and rotary sushi restaurants called Sushi Misaki Maru, Kaisen Misakiko, and Kyotaru; and Overseas, which operates primarily Yoshinoya restaurants in China, the United States, Thailand, and Malaysia. The company has roughly 2,000 stores in Japan and nearly 700 outside Japan.
